Stickam was a live video streaming platform that gained popularity in the early 2000s. At its peak, the site attracted millions of users and became a hub for live video broadcasts, ranging from music performances to comedy sketches. The platform faced criticism from lawmakers, parents, and online safety advocates, who argued that Stickam was not doing enough to protect minors and prevent the spread of explicit material. In response to mounting pressure, Stickam implemented stricter moderation policies and began to remove explicit content from the platform.
